Our Client is a global leader in stainless steel with a crude stainless steel capacity of 3.1 million tonnes. They create advanced materials that are efficient, long lasting and recyclable – helping to build a world that lasts forever.
This division are based in Sheffield producing specialist hot rolled stainless rod and bar products.
They are looking to appoint a Shift Mechanical Technician – Engineering who will carry out mechanical maintenance and improvements across the ASR plant, ensuring that efficiency is maximised. Working shifts in a mechanical team of two, you will cover the mechanical operations within a heavy engineering plant.
Within the role you will fault find on hydraulics and pneumatics to component level, using engineering drawings to identify faults and resolve problems on the plant. Having responsibility for the maintenance of the mill mechanical plant, you will also be responsible for the mechanical maintenance of overhead DC and AC cranes, and of pumps, including many utilised on acid systems. Optimising preventative maintenance programs and reacting to breakdown requirements to safely and promptly rectify faults, you will assist in production changeovers as required.
As the successful candidate, you will be time served with a recognised apprenticeship or equivalent to NVQ level 3. With the ability to understand and interpret mechanical drawings and technical data, you will have a knowledge of PC systems and will maintain good housekeeping standards in your own work area as well as on plant.
